## Sensor drift: what to do at 3am

If the GrowLoop controller starts reporting humidity swings that don't match the backup probes in the Fernwick greenhouse, it's almost always sensor drift, not an actual climate event. Don't panic and don't touch the vents manually. First, restart the calibration daemon and give it ten minutes to re-baseline. If readings still disagree by more than 5%, flip the controller into safe mode. The safe-mode thresholds it will use are these.

config for yahap-bajof:
[istix]
host = istix.qorvelsys.internal
user = istix_svc
database = istix_prod

## Nightfill Scheduler — Onboarding Note

Nightfill runs the nightly data backfills for the Corvane warehouse. Jobs are defined declaratively, signed at merge time, and executed under a scoped service role with no interactive access. For your review: all schedule changes require two approvals, and execution logs are immutable for 90 days. Manual reruns are disabled except through the sealed recovery console, which operators unlock with the passphrase below.

vault phrase of yawig-bawig = fenael-norael-eliox-gilox-casath-druath-zorys-istwyn-jorwyn

**Release checklist — Fernwick mobile v4.2**

- [ ] Verify deep links: tapping a shared recipe should open the recipe screen, not the home feed. This broke twice before because the router config gets regenerated at build time and silently drops custom schemes. Test on both platforms, cold start and warm. Log the verified build token below so future-you can trace it.

pipeline stamp: htk31_32b48784f8c83c96a621312a3a842c7

**Q: Why did the Pathgrove driver-assignment heuristic change between releases?**

The scoring weights were retuned in release 4.2 to reduce idle time in low-density zones. No configuration action is needed; defaults carry forward automatically. If regression metrics appear during rollout, pause the release rather than rolling back weights manually. Direct any scoring anomalies to the routing team at the address below.

pager mailbox: istael.fenwyn@qorvelworks.corp